KB ID 0000821 Problem Both ‘box product’ or retail versions of Office require you to add the key and activate them at install time. But volume licensed or MAK versions do not. This makes it easy for you to forget. If you use KMS that’s not a problem, by default they will licence themselves from there. KB ID 0000513  Problem Seen Installing Lync Server 2010 on Windows Server 2008 R2, during the “Setup or Remove Lync Server Components” phase of the Deployment Wizard. Error: Prerequisite installation failed: Wmf2008R2 Details Type: PreInstallFailed Solution Thankfully this is a know problem and Microsoft has addressed it with KB 2522454 1. KB ID 0000529  Problem Saw this on a brand new installation on my test bench, I left it overnight and the problem still did not resolve. Solution 1. On the Lync 2010 Server launch the “Lync Server Management Shell” and execute the following command: Update-CsAddressBook 2.
